ARTIFACT: This is a United States Army Regulations Manual entitled "Wear and Appearance of Army Uniforms and Insignia" 670-1. It was published just after the Desert Storm era, in September 1992.

VINTAGE: Circa just post-Desert Storm era (published September 1992).

SIZE: 186 pages, with illustrations and a few fold-out diagrams; approximately 10-7/8" in height and 8-7/16" in width and 1/4" in thickness.

MATERIALS / CONSTRUCTION: Stock paper cover, newsprint.

ATTACHMENT: Glued binding, punched holes.

MARKINGS: ARMY REGULATION 670-1 HEADQUARTERS DEPARTMENT OF THE ARMY WASHINGTON DC 1 SEPTEMBER 1992.
